运维

运维

Products

当前位置:首页 > 运维 >

如何轻松解决CentOS上Minio安装难题?

96SEO 2025-05-13 23:28 3


CentOS上MinIO对象存储服务的安装与配置

在当今巨大数据、 人造智能和机器学领域,高大效的数据存储解决方案变得至关关键。MinIO作为一款高大性能、开源的对象存储系统,给了轻巧松且可 的存储解决方案,特别适用于这些个领域。本文将深厚入探讨怎么在CentOS上安装和配置MinIO对象存储服务。

1. 安装准备

在开头安装之前, 确保您的CentOS周围满足以下要求:

解决centos minio安装难题
  • 系统版本:CentOS 7或更高大版本
  • 结实件要求:足够的存储地方和内存
  • 网络周围:确保网络连接稳稳当当

2. 安装MinIO

2.1 下载MinIO安装包

先说说您需要从MinIO官网下载适合Linux AMD64架构的安装包。能用以下命令下载:

bash wget https://dl.min.io/server/minio/release/linux-amd64/minio

2.2 赋予施行权限

下载完成后 为安装包赋予施行权限:

bash chmod +x minio

2.3 创建数据目录

创建MinIO数据存储目录,并设置用户权限:

bash sudo mkdir -p /data/minio sudo chown minio:minio /data/minio

2.4 配置MinIO

编辑/etc/default/minio文件,设置MinIO配置:

bash sudo vi /etc/default/minio

将以下内容添加到文件中:

bash MINIO_VOLUMES="/data/minio" MINIO_OPTS="-C /etc/minio --address YOUR_NODE_IP:9000"

YOUR_NODE_IP替换为当前节点的IP地址。

2.5 启动MinIO

启动MinIO服务:

bash sudo ./minio server /data

2.6 设置开机自启动

创建/etc/systemd/system/minio.service文件, 并添加以下内容:

bash Description=MinIO Server Documentation=https:///docs/minio/linux Wants=network After=network

Type=forking Environment="MINIOROOTUSER=minioadmin" Environment="MINIOROOTPASSWORD=your_password" ExecStart=/usr/local/bin/minio server /data Restart=always LimitNOFILE=65536 TasksMax=infinity TimeoutStopSec=infinity SendSIGKILL=no

WantedBy=multi-user.target

沉新鲜加载systemd配置并启动服务:

bash sudo systemctl daemon-reload sudo systemctl start minio sudo systemctl enable minio

3. 验证安装

用以下命令验证MinIO服务是不是正常运行:

bash mc ls

4. 注意事项

  • 确保全部节点的时候同步,时候差不能超出3秒。
  • 在生产周围中,觉得能用Docker容器化部署,以便于管理和 。
  • 配置防火墙以开放MinIO用的端口。

通过以上步骤,您得能够在CentOS上成功安装并运行MinIO。如有随便哪个问题,请参考MinIO的官方文档或联系支持团队。


标签: CentOS

提交需求或反馈

Demand feedback